The acronym stands for Co llins B irmingham U niversity I nternational L anguage D atabase. First launched in the 1980s, it revolutionized lexicography by using a massive computerized database of real human speech and text (a corpus).

The is a cornerstone resource for learners of English, renowned for its focus on authentic usage and corpus-based data . Developed by Collins ELT , it leverages the Collins Corpus —a massive database of real-world English—to ensure every definition and example reflects how the language is actually spoken and written. The Collins COBUILD (Collins Birmingham University International Language Database) series is renowned for its corpus-based approach, meaning all definitions and examples are based on real, contemporary English rather than just theoretical usage.

Thousands of examples drawn from the Collins Corpus, showing words in context.

The dictionary also includes helpful usage notes, which provide additional information on the phrasal verb, such as its idiomatic meaning, its transitive or intransitive nature, and any special prepositions that are used with it.
